Overview

Covent Garden once held the quintessential farmer’s market. In over 150 photos, Clive Boursnell documents the era that ended when the stalls moved out of the garden. This beautiful book presents portraits of the people who worked and shopped at the markets and also captures the distinctive character of the streets and architecture though every season. The book also includes faithfully transcribed interviews with the people who knew the market best: the porters, stallholders, and flower sellers.
